Restrictions
Some religions don't allow you to do certain things. Here are a few examples.
In various popular practices of christianity, Lent is observed. Because of this, many people choose to give up various things and/or activities, leading to different social climates.
In Mormonism, alcohol, smoking and other harmful substances/practices are forbidden. This would prevent a Mormon from, let's say, going out to the pub with their friends on the weekends.
